摘 要:为探讨不同外源激素种类、浓度和处理时间对香花油茶(Camellia osmantha)扦插生根效果的影响,提高扦插生根质量,采用L9(34)正交试验,运用方差分析、主成分分析和极差分析方法对香花油茶扦插生根效果进行综合评价。结果表明,不同处理的香花油茶扦插存活率、生根率、根系长度、根系表面积、根系体积和根系平均直径均差异显著,扦插生根综合效果排序为Ⅷ(1000 mg/L NAA处理5 s)>IX(1500 mg/L NAA处理30 s)>Ⅵ(1500 mg/L IBA处理5 s);各因素对扦插综合指标的影响依次为激素浓度>激素种类>处理时间。In order to investigate effects of different exogenous hormone treatments on rooting of Camellia osmantha and improve rooting quality, L9(34) orthogonal experiment was designed to evaluate rooting of C. osmantha by variance analysis, principal component analysis and range analysis. Results showed that there were significant differences in survival rate of cuttage, rooting rate, root length, root surface area, root volume and average root diameter of C. osmantha among different treatments. The order of comprehensive effects of rooting was Ⅷ(1 000 mg/L NAA for 5 s)>IX(1 500 mg/L NAA for 30 s)>Ⅵ(1 500 mg/L IBA for 5 s), and order of effects of each factor on comprehensive index was hormone concentration>hormone type > treatment time.
